Tasker does one thing: mention a person or a team to do something or look at something. No chat, no channels, no noise, just mentions that don't disappear.
Chat is where mentions go to die. Tasker makes every mention a trackable item that stays open until it's handled.
Tag @a-person or @a-team with what you need: "take a look at this", "review this ticket", "fix this before Friday". That's the whole interaction.
Every mention stays in the recipient's queue until they act on it. No burying, no "sorry, missed this" three days later.
Each mention has a status. You know the moment it's been seen, and you know if it's been sitting unseen for two days.
Mention @design or @backend and the first available person claims it. No guessing who's free or who owns what.
Unseen mentions nudge again. Still nothing? It escalates to the team lead. Important things stop slipping through.
Tag someone on a support ticket, an HR request, or a Service Desk issue. One mention system across all of DeskPoint.
